1912-14, Washington-Franklin sheet stamps, 2¢ to $1, "COLONIAS" (Portuguese Specimen) overprints (Scott 406//423), ten values comprising #406-407, 414-419 and 422-423 (unclear which watermark the 50¢ has, so we assumed the lower Scott value), each with straightline "COLONIAS" overprint in blue/violet or magenta, affixed to page (cut-outs from original Portuguese UPU ledger book); stamps generally fresh and attractively centered with clear strike of the overprint; small scuffs at bottom of $1, generally Fine to Very Fine, the Portuguese replaced their "Ultramar" overprint with "COLONIAS" in 1911, extremely rare, and quite possibly unique. 1912, 2¢ lake, S.L. watermark, perf 12 (Scott 406c), o.g., hinged, in bold, deep color with proof-like impression; pristine paper sporting perfectly balanced margins, Extremely Fine, with 2016 P.S.A.G. certificate. Scott $3,000 Estimate $2,000-3,000 (Image)
